diff options
author | Lars Wirzenius <liw@liw.fi> | 2018-09-09 18:06:01 +0300 |
---|---|---|
committer | Lars Wirzenius <liw@liw.fi> | 2018-09-09 18:06:01 +0300 |
commit | 805305d45439172f256ea26c87e4b75ae2ca45fc (patch) | |
tree | d61e24d15d512f54147adc977eb2ff2cb38b2067 /ick_helpers.py | |
parent | 4ba6b46206a03bf6815d46cff12cfb0c2033795c (diff) | |
download | ick-helpers-805305d45439172f256ea26c87e4b75ae2ca45fc.tar.gz |
Fix: parsing of full version to upstream, debian parts
Diffstat (limited to 'ick_helpers.py')
-rw-r--r-- | ick_helpers.py |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/ick_helpers.py b/ick_helpers.py index b1c9e2f..24aef44 100644 --- a/ick_helpers.py +++ b/ick_helpers.py @@ -139,15 +139,15 @@ class Version: @property def upstream(self): - parts = self._full_version.split('-', 1) - return parts[0] + parts = self._full_version.split('-') + return '-'.join(parts[:-1]) @property def debian(self): - parts = self._full_version.split('-', 1) + parts = self._full_version.split('-') if len(parts) == 1: return None - return parts[1] + return parts[-1] class DebianBuilderBase: @@ -285,6 +285,7 @@ class DebianCIBuilder(DebianBuilderBase): self.set_distribution(version, distribution) + self.ex.run('find', '-ls') self.create_dsc() self.build_deb() |